Dr. Charlie Gnaim is a cardiologist practicing in Houston, TX. Dr. Gnaim specializes in diagnosing, monitoring, and treating diseases or conditions of the heart and blood vessels and the cardiovascular system. These conditions include heart attacks, heart murmurs, coronary heart disease, and hypertension. Dr. Gnaim also practices preventative medicine, helping patients maintain a heart-healthy life.
